How to find cheap flights from Toronto to Vancouver

Vancouver, British Columbia, draws travellers with its diverse attractions. From its celebrated art scene and historical neighbourhoods to the impressive coastal rainforests and mountain backdrops, the city offers a wide range of experiences. It’s a place where urban exploration meets outdoor adventure, reflecting a rich heritage alongside contemporary local life.

Flying from Toronto to Vancouver is a popular route, with flights typically lasting around 5 hours. For those looking to find optimal travel times, shoulder seasons often present a good balance. Spring (April to June) and fall (September to October) offer pleasant weather and fewer crowds compared to the busy summer months. If you’re planning a winter trip, be aware that while the city itself rarely sees heavy snow, the nearby mountains offer excellent skiing opportunities. For the best deals, consider booking your flight a few months in advance. Many airlines operate this route daily, providing numerous options throughout the week.

Useful information about Toronto airports

Your journey from Toronto to Vancouver begins at one of Toronto’s main airports.

Toronto Pearson International Airport (YYZ)

This is Canada's busiest airport, serving as a major hub for both domestic and international flights. Travellers departing from here will find a wide range of services, including numerous car rental options and extensive public transit connections, making it accessible from various parts of the Greater Toronto Area for your flight discovery.

Billy Bishop Toronto City Airport (YTZ)

Located on Toronto Island, Billy Bishop Toronto City Airport offers a convenient downtown location, making it ideal for those seeking proximity to the urban core. Access to the airport is primarily via a pedestrian tunnel or a short ferry ride, providing a unique start to your destination journey. It primarily handles regional flights within Canada and to the United States.

Airports in Vancouver: good to know

Begin your journey to Vancouver, a key destination for travellers arriving from Toronto. The region is served by several airports handling commercial flights.

Vancouver International Airport (YVR)

Located on Sea Island in Richmond, just 12 kilometres from downtown Vancouver, this airport is the primary hub for air travel in British Columbia. It serves as a major gateway for both domestic and international flights, offering extensive connections across North America and to global destinations. Travellers will find a comprehensive range of services and facilities here.

Abbotsford International Airport (YXX)

Situated approximately 60 kilometres east of Vancouver, Abbotsford International Airport provides an alternative entry point to the region, particularly for budget-conscious travellers. It primarily handles domestic flights within Canada, connecting passengers to various cities across the country, making it a viable option for those exploring British Columbia.

How many hours is the flight from Hamilton to Vancouver?
Flying between Hamilton and Vancouver generally takes about 6 h and 8 m, for a distance of approximately 3,340.41 km. Times may vary depending on whether you choose a direct flight or one with layovers.
What’s the weather like in Vancouver vs. Hamilton?
In summer, Hamilton experiences average highs of 20.87 ºC. At the same time, Vancouver can reach 16.77 ºC. In winter, the climate is cooler, averaging -2.05 ºC in Hamilton compared to 3.85 ºC in Vancouver.
